What it is
The IHG One Rewards Traveler is a Chase card earning IHG One Rewards points. Its ongoing value can outweigh the annual fee, making it a potential keeper past year one. The no-fee way into IHG — an easy churn for the welcome bonus with nothing to cancel later. A good first IHG card.
